Duplicating Folders
Duplicate a folder.
1)
Drag the folder in the folder view, and drop it onto the duplicate destination folder with [Ctrl] on the
keyboard held down.
f
Registered clips are also copied.
1
Alternative
f
Right-drag and drop the folder to duplicate onto the destination folder, and click [Copy folder].
2
f
The [root] folder cannot be copied.
Deleting Folders
Delete a folder.
1)
Select the folder to delete in the folder view, and click [Delete] in the bin.
f
A dialog box appears to confirm the deletion.
2)
Click [Yes].
1
Alternative
f
Select a folder, press [Delete] on the keyboard, and click [Yes].
f
Right-click the folder, and click [Delete] and then [Yes].
2
f
When the [root] folder has been right-clicked and [Delete All] has been clicked, all clips and folders in the [root] folder are deregistered.
3
Note
f
Once you delete a folder, you cannot restore it (cannot undo deletion).
f
When a folder is deleted, all clips in that folder and sub folders are also deregistered.
Switching the Display Folder
Switch the folder to be displayed.
1)
Click the folder to be displayed in the folder view.
f
If the folder view is closed, right-click a blank space of the clip view and click [Go], and click the move destination folder name or [Up one
Folder].
1
Alternative
f
Click [Move Up] in the bin to switch the folder.
f
Moving to a folder one place up:
[Backspace]
